Urban Hunting

Urban hunting presents unique challenges and opportunities. As urban areas expand and encroach on wildlife habitats, managing urban wildlife populations becomes essential. Many cities now permit controlled hunting to maintain ecological balance and mitigate human-wildlife conflicts. Here are some tips for urban hunters:


Know the Regulations: Familiarize yourself with local hunting regulations and restrictions in urban areas. Obtain the necessary permits and adhere to hunting season schedules.


Safety First: Safety is paramount when hunting in populated areas. Be aware of your surroundings and always have a clear line of sight of your target. Consider using smaller caliber firearms or bowhunting to minimize noise and disturbance.


Scouting: Urban hunting requires careful scouting. Identify green spaces, parks, or designated hunting areas within the city limits where you can legally hunt. Pay attention to wildlife movement patterns.


Ethical Considerations: Respect private property rights and adhere to ethical hunting practices. Ensure you have permission to hunt on private land if necessary.


Rural Hunting

Rural environments offer vast expanses of hunting opportunities, but they come with their own set of challenges. Whether you're in farmland, forests, or rolling hills, rural hunting requires a different approach:


Scouting: Spend time scouting the area, understanding the terrain, and tracking the movement of wildlife. Familiarize yourself with property boundaries and obtain permission from landowners.


Camouflage and Stealth: In rural settings, blending into the environment is crucial. Wear appropriate camouflage and move quietly to avoid spooking game.


Hunting Gear: Depending on the game you're pursuing, ensure you have the right hunting gear, including firearms or archery equipment, optics, and clothing suitable for the weather conditions.


Safety: Rural areas may be more isolated, so ensure someone knows your whereabouts and carry essential safety equipment, such as first aid kits and communication devices.


Wilderness Hunting

Wilderness hunting offers a truly immersive experience in pristine natural settings. Whether you're hunting deep in the mountains, dense forests, or vast wilderness expanses, preparation is key:


Fitness and Endurance: Wilderness hunting often involves long hikes and rugged terrain. Ensure you are physically fit and prepared for the challenges of the wilderness.


Navigation Skills: Familiarize yourself with topographical maps, GPS devices, and compass navigation to avoid getting lost in remote areas.


Survival Skills: Be well-versed in wilderness survival skills, including fire-starting, shelter-building, and water purification, in case of emergencies.


Leave No Trace: Respect the environment by following Leave No Trace principles. Dispose of waste properly and minimize your impact on the wilderness.
